Page MenuHomePhabricator

Archive the MediaWikiAuth extension from Gerrit (Moved to Github)
Open, Needs TriagePublicRequest

Description

Reason
The canonical repository for this extension has moved to GitHub: https://github.com/SkizNet/mediawiki-MediaWikiAuth

To-do list

Event Timeline

Change 691748 had a related patch set uploaded (by Jforrester; author: Skizzerz):

[integration/config@master] Zuul: [mediawiki/extensions/MediaWikiAuth] Mark repo as archived

https://gerrit.wikimedia.org/r/691748

Change 691748 merged by jenkins-bot:

[integration/config@master] Zuul: [mediawiki/extensions/MediaWikiAuth] Mark repo as archived

https://gerrit.wikimedia.org/r/691748

Mentioned in SAL (#wikimedia-releng) [2021-05-15T21:09:55Z] <James_F> Zuul: [mediawiki/extensions/MediaWikiAuth] Mark repo as archived T282955

Jdforrester-WMF added a subscriber: Jdforrester-WMF.

Presumably you want to abandon the five open patches?

Not objecting or anything, but is there a reason for this? Extensions being split out, or this one isn't used in Wikimedia? I'm not regularly involved in development so am not aware of any codebase-wise changes (have been poking at Wikibase/WBStack recently for an upgrade, though).

Presumably you want to abandon the five open patches?

I'm going to be going through the open patches, fixing them up, and committing them to the new repository (crediting the original authors appropriately). So for the time being I'd like to keep them open so that I know which ones still need to be worked on.

Change 691749 had a related patch set uploaded (by Jforrester; author: Jforrester):

[mediawiki/extensions/MediaWikiAuth@master] Empty repo and indicate that it's archived

https://gerrit.wikimedia.org/r/691749

Change 691749 merged by Jforrester:

[mediawiki/extensions/MediaWikiAuth@master] Empty repo and indicate that it's archived

https://gerrit.wikimedia.org/r/691749

Not objecting or anything, but is there a reason for this? Extensions being split out, or this one isn't used in Wikimedia? I'm not regularly involved in development so am not aware of any codebase-wise changes (have been poking at Wikibase/WBStack recently for an upgrade, though).

It's a fair question! Mostly I'm (slowly) going to be splitting out the extensions that I've been providing the primary maintenance on so that I have full control over CI and who has the ability to merge commits. I've kept Isarra and Jack Phoenix as maintainers on the new repository as they have both been involved with submitting and reviewing patches to it recently and they should be able to keep that access.

I haven't seen you recently send any commits to this repo or do Code Review, but if you'd like to maintain your access please let me know.

Change 691750 had a related patch set uploaded (by Skizzerz; author: Skizzerz):

[mediawiki/extensions@master] Remove archived extension MediaWikiAuth

https://gerrit.wikimedia.org/r/691750

Change 691750 merged by Jforrester:

[mediawiki/extensions@master] Remove archived extension MediaWikiAuth

https://gerrit.wikimedia.org/r/691750

Change 691747 had a related patch set uploaded (by Skizzerz; author: Skizzerz):

[translatewiki@master] Add GitHub repo MediaWikiAuth

https://gerrit.wikimedia.org/r/691747

Presumably you want to abandon the five open patches?

I'm going to be going through the open patches, fixing them up, and committing them to the new repository (crediting the original authors appropriately). So for the time being I'd like to keep them open so that I know which ones still need to be worked on.

Ah, sorry, I abandoned them so that I could mark the repo as read-only. They're here: https://gerrit.wikimedia.org/r/q/project:mediawiki/extensions/MediaWikiAuth+is:abandoned+-age:1y

I haven't seen you recently send any commits to this repo or do Code Review, but if you'd like to maintain your access please let me know.

I think we can leave it for now. No need to keep permissions around that aren't being used, and it's been a while since I knew my way around the codebase. If there are any issues, I'll probably file them on GitHub, as I have for WBStack.

Glad to see it has 1.36 support, as I plan to move WikiFur to that this year, and we still get people with accounts from the Wikicities days even though it's been well over a decade. 😼

Peachey88 renamed this task from Archive the MediaWikiAuth extension to Archive the MediaWikiAuth extension from Gerrit (Moved to Github).May 16 2021, 12:44 AM

Change 692023 had a related patch set uploaded (by Raimond Spekking; author: Raimond Spekking):

[translatewiki@master] [MediaWiki Auth] Archived, moved to GitHub

https://gerrit.wikimedia.org/r/692023

Change 692023 merged by Raimond Spekking:

[translatewiki@master] [MediaWiki Auth] Archived, moved to GitHub

https://gerrit.wikimedia.org/r/692023